How Lifeline Supports Communication Access 

The Lifeline program is a federally mandated assistance service designed to improve access to critical communication tools for qualifying low-income individuals. The goal is simple: ensure everyone has the ability to call for help, keep in touch with loved ones, attend virtual appointments, and participate in modern society. Through Lifeline, eligible customers receive benefits that reduce or eliminate the cost of phone service, making reliable connectivity possible for those who need it most. 

Assurance Wireless participates in this program by offering plans that may include free talk, text, and data, ensuring users can reach essential services at any time. Whether someone needs to schedule a medical appointment, contact childcare assistance, or respond to a potential employer, Assurance Wireless provides a dependable resource that supports safe and productive living.
